| Members oppose Negros Billiards Stable top man Jonathan Sy along with pool icon Efren “Bata” Reyes, Aristeo “Putch” Puyat and six other billiards stalwarts in the country sought the intervention of the Philippine Olympic Committee in the long-standing crisis hounding the sport. The group filed a petition before the POC requesting the local Olympic body to compel their organization, the Billiards and Snooker Congress of the Philippines, to hold an election to settle the internal squabble. In the letter addressed to POC president Jose “Peping” Cojuangco, the nine BSCP members objected the act of BSCP chairman Yen Makabenta and president Ernesto Fajardo of including new names in the list of voting members and then calling for an election. | ||||||||||||||||
